The Furies Were A 1970s Lesbian Feminist Collective That Advanced The Notion Of Lesbian Separatism To Correct What They Called The “Zig-Zag And Haphazard” Straight Women’s Movement. The Furies Were Intense: Twelve Women Began The Group, Worked Together, And Then Broke Up In Just Under Two Years. In That Short Time, They Wrote And Published A Widely Read Newspaper (Also Called The Furies) That Advanced Their Ideology And Still Seems Relevant 50 Years Later. “Once A Fury” Profiles Former Members Of The Furies, The Notorious 1970s Lesbian Separatist Collective That Published A National Newspaper And Planned To Seize State Power. The Film Features Interviews With 10 Of The Original 12 Furies, Photography By Jeb (Joan E. Biren), And Archival Materials.
